Description: Upptime is an open-source uptime monitor and status page, designed for monitoring HTTP/HTTPS sites and APIs. It features customizable status pages, SMS/email notifications, history graphs, detailed uptime analytics, and more.

Upptime
Upptime Features
  • Uptime monitoring
  • Status pages
  • Alert notifications via email, SMS, Slack, etc
  • Response time metrics
  • Customizable status page branding
  • Uptime and response time graphs
  • Detailed uptime analytics
